Course Description

The Shell Lake Arts Center in partnership with Yamaha is proud to present Saxophone Workshop. World renowned saxophonist, Eugene Rousseau leads a team of top performers and gifted educators at the Saxophone Workshop. This program is designed to meet the needs of participants from various backgrounds. Each day is structured to comprise a series of events and classes, including saxophone ensemble, in which all enrolled will play. There will be sessions devoted to saxophone literature, and to the interpretation of music. The performance in class of solos and chamber music is both welcomed and encouraged. In addition, a wide range of materials prepared by the instructors will be given to each person enrolled. Class sessions each day are planned to cover virtually every aspect of saxophone pedagogy, including:

  • Tone Production
  • Vibrato
  • Articulation
  • Phrasing
  • Reeds and Reed Adjustment
  • Mouthpieces
  • Tuning and Intonation
  • Methods and Materials
  • Repertory
  • Extended Techniques
